How to Break In New Shoes: My Top Tips & & Tricks.
Know that usually, your feet simply require to get used to the shoes!.
Every year when the seasons modification and I start using different kinds of shoes, I get blisters and areas that rub– even on shoes that are several years old and completely broken in! It just includes the territory.
Same opts for a new set of shoes I know will be exceptionally comfortable– there are still areas that can rub in the beginning, because my feet just need time to get utilized to them!
All of this to say– dont write off a set of shoes if at first they give you blisters. If everything else about them feels comfy and good, opportunities are, theyll be your comfiest pair in no time..

For shoes that rub:.
Here are my leading tips for shoes that rub:.
# 1: Invest in blister bandaids.
My all-time primary pointer. I hope its this if you take absolutely nothing else away from this post!
The best blister bandaids (for avoidance and securing existing blisters) are “blister cushions”– if youre in Europe, appearance for the brand name “Compeed”– which they have in every pharmacy. They likewise offer the brand name here as well (but I found theyre more costly here!) Amazon makes some fantastic knockoffs. They work so well and are waterproof and rub-proof!

They remain on for several days and once you put one on, you genuinely cant feel your blister any longer! Utilize them on areas that already injured or as a preventative– put them on if you know you have an area thats going to rub, and you will not have any blisters!.
After a few uses, your feet will get utilized to the shoes and you wont need the blister bandages any longer..
# 2: Stick these no-rub heel pads on the backs of shoes that rub.
For shoes that are comfortable otherwise and simply rub on your heels, these are incredible! I always utilize these for trips where Im logging a lots of miles daily and know I will have unavoidable rubbing areas. Due to the fact that they go on your shoes (not your feet) and stay put for months and months, these are a good alternative to the blister band-aids. (Pictured above on my Huarache sandals).

For shoes that are stiff or tight:.
In some cases the measure is too big, but the existing size is just a TEENY bit tight. Or you know the leather will break in with wear, however today, its just too stiff. Heres what to do then:.
# 1: Spray stiffer leather with shoe stretch.
This shoe stretch spray is incredible to make leather softer and permit shoes to finest type to your feet. I used this to help break in my Nisolo Huarache sandals and it worked like an appeal.
# 2: Wear shoes around the house with socks.
This permits you to break them in a bit at a time! Super thick socks will assist your shoes stretch (especially if you spray them thoroughly with shoe stretch spray ahead of time or steam them with a cleaner). This is how I broke in my Birkenstocks!.
